Zoning
R-1
Single-Family Residential District
The R-1 District is the most restrictive residential district. The principal use is single-family residential with provisions for related recreational, religious and educational facilities that are normally required to provide the basic elements of a balanced and attractive residential area. Internal stability, attractiveness, order and efficiency are encouraged by providing adequate light, air and open space for dwellings and related facilities, and through consideration of the proper functional relationships of each element.
